Identification and expression of main genes involved in non-target site resistance mechanisms to fenoxaprop-p-ethyl in Beckmannia syzigachne.
Pest management science - 1 Aug 2020
Bai Shuang, Zhao Yanfang, Zhou Yuanming, Wang Mingliang, Li Yihui, Luo Xiaoyong, Li Lingxu
Abstract excerpt
BACKGROUND: Non-target-site resistance (NTSR) to herbicides is a serious threat to global agriculture. Although metabolic resistance is the dominant mechanism of NTSR, the molecular mechanisms are not yet well-characterized.
